Abstract
The integration of artificial intelligence (AI) into education has the
potential to transform the way we learn and teach. In this paper, we examine
the current state of AI in education and explore the potential benefits and
challenges of incorporating this technology into the classroom. The approaches
currently available for AI education often present students with experiences
only focusing on discrete computer science concepts agnostic to a larger
curriculum. However, teaching AI must not be siloed or interdisciplinary.
Rather, AI instruction ought to be transdisciplinary, including connections to
the broad curriculum and community in which students are learning. This paper
delves into the AI program currently in development for Neom Community School
and the larger Education, Research, and Innovation Sector in Neom, Saudi Arabia
s new megacity under development. In this program, AI is both taught as a
subject and to learn other subjects within the curriculum through the school
systems International Baccalaureate (IB) approach, which deploys learning
through Units of Inquiry. This approach to education connects subjects across a
curriculum under one major guiding question at a time. The proposed method
offers a meaningful approach to introducing AI to students throughout these
Units of Inquiry, as it shifts AI from a subject that students like or not like
to a subject that is taught throughout the curriculum.
